Title: The Innovative Mind of Jinendra K Gugaliya
Introduction: Jinendra K Gugaliya is a prominent inventor based in Karnataka, India, known for his significant contributions to the fields of industrial automation and process engineering. With a remarkable portfolio of 10 patents, Jinendra’s work embodies innovation that drives efficiency and accuracy in various technological applications.
Latest Patents: Among his latest patents, two stand out due to their direct application in improving process plant operations. The first patent is titled "Method and Control System for Detecting Faults Associated with Gas Chromatograph Device in Process Plant." This invention outlines a sophisticated method for detecting faults in gas chromatograph devices by leveraging machine learning and historical data. The server detects symptoms in real-time by comparing current chromatograms with historical data stored in a dedicated database. This proactive approach enables swift identification and resolution of operational issues.
The second notable patent is the "System and Method for Generating HMI Graphics." This computer-implemented method focuses on industrial automation systems and integrates machine learning to enhance human-machine interface (HMI) graphics. By identifying and correcting missing graphical objects in legacy systems, this invention ensures more accurate and effective communication between machinery and operators.
